Taxonomic Classification

Rank Azure Bluet Natal Red Rock Hare
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Arthropoda (Arthropods)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Insecta (Insects)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Odonata (Odonata) Lagomorpha (Rabbits & Hares)
Family Coenagrionidae Leporidae (Rabbits & Hares)
Genus Coenagrion Pronolagus
Species Coenagrion puella Pronolagus crassicaudatus

Evolutionary Relationship

Azure Bluet and Natal Red Rock Hare share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)

Azure Bluet

Azure Bluet (Coenagrion puella) is classified as Least Concern (LC) on the IUCN Red List. Widespread and abundant across its range, with stable populations and no immediate conservation concerns.
